Virtual reality for extrusion operations

$15.00

This paper examines virtual gauge technology (VGT) which takes virtual measurements in wire and cable extrusion applications, including jacketing or sheathing operations. It is designed to overcome hindrances to placement of wall thickness and diameter measurement systems directly after the extruder crosshead. It helps to optimize the extrusion process by using immediate virtual values while comparing real-time cold end values in a time-delayed same-point basis.
